Notice to Interested Parties

Purpose of this Notice

The City of Niagara Falls (City) is undertaking a market engagement exercise to identify potential technology providers with experience delivering Artificial Intelligence (AI)‑enabled solutions to support building permit and zoning review processes in a Canadian (Ontario) municipal environment.

This notice is intended to invite qualified and experienced parties to express interest in potential opportunities related to AI-assisted building and zoning review software.

This notice does not constitute a Request for Quotations, Request for Tenders, or Request for Proposals, or a commitment to procure goods or services.

Background

As outlined in the Council-approved report PBD‑2026‑20 – Artificial Intelligence Building and Zoning Review Software Project, the City has received authorization to proceed with a modified procurement approach, including the ability to engage the market, explore cooperative procurement opportunities, and negotiate, in accordance with the City’s Procurement Policy.

Funding has been approved within the 2026 Capital Budget to pursue an AI‑enabled solution intended to:

  • Improve efficiency and consistency in zoning and building permit reviews
  • Reduce incomplete or insufficient application submissions
  • Support staff capacity and address workload pressures
  • Improve turnaround times for development applications
  • Integrate with the City’s existing permitting and planning systems

The City is seeking to understand the range of available, proven solutions currently in the market that may be suitable for Ontario municipalities.

What the City Is Interested In

The City is interested in hearing from qualified Suppliers  that can demonstrate experience delivering AI‑assisted or rules‑based software solutions that support the following functions:

  • Zoning by-law compliance check
  • Building permit review assistance
  • Application submission checks for building and planning based on required application submission information
  • Automated or semi‑automated identification of missing or non‑compliant materials
  • Integration with the City’s existing municipal permitting and planning system (e.g., Cityview)
  • Secure handling of municipal data in compliance with privacy and cybersecurity requirements

Solutions may use artificial intelligence, machine learning, rules engines, or a combination of techniques to support regulatory review processes.

Who Should Respond

This notice is intended for experienced Suppliers who:

  • Offer an existing, market‑ready solution (not conceptual or under development)
  • Have a proven track record and demonstrated municipal experience, particularly in planning, building, zoning, or regulatory environments
  • Can support implementation, integration, and ongoing operational use in a Canadian (Ontario) municipal context
  • Have the capacity to engage in technical discussions or demonstrations, if requested.

Nature of Engagement

At this stage, the City is seeking high‑level information only, such as:

  • A brief description of your solution and how it applies to municipal building and zoning review
  • Examples of municipal or public‑sector deployments
  • Key functional capabilities
  • Integration considerations, including with CityView
  • A general implementation approach

Detailed pricing, proposals, or formal submissions are not required.

The City may, at its sole discretion, engage with selected parties for discussions and demonstrations, or gather further information to better understand available solutions and procurement options.
